Weather updates: Rain, storm hit Islamabad, Peshawar

ISLAMABAD: Citizens in Islamabad and Peshawar experienced a sudden change in weather as both cities received rainfall accompanied by strong winds and stormy conditions. In the federal capital, authorities remained on the ground and coordinated with traffic police to ensure smooth flow of traffic amid the weather disruption.
In Islamabad, rain began in several areas late Tuesday evening. Residents have been advised to avoid unnecessary travel during severe weather conditions to ensure safety.
Following the rainfall, a tree fell onto a vehicle on Ibn-e-Sina Road in Sector G10-3 due to strong winds, leaving one person injured. The injured individual was shifted to hospital for medical treatment, while rescue teams later cleared the tree and vehicle from the road, according to Capital Emergency Services.
Meanwhile, Peshawar also witnessed stormy winds that disrupted daily life and caused widespread power outages across the city and surrounding areas. According to a PESCO spokesperson, electricity supply from multiple grids was suspended as more than 200 feeders linked to 12 grids tripped due to the strong winds.
PESCO officials added that power restoration will begin gradually once the intensity of the storm subsides, while emergency teams have been placed on high alert to manage the situation.
